PermalinkGiriş
Günümüzün dijital çağında, web sitesi performansı, çevrimiçi ziyaretçileri çekmek ve elde tutmak için çok önemlidir. Bir içerik yazarı olarak, verimli kodlama uygulamalarının önemini ve bunların web sitesi performansı üzerindeki etkisini anlamak çok önemlidir. Bu makale, HTML küçültücüler dünyasını inceliyor ve kod optimizasyonu yoluyla web sitesi performansını nasıl artırabileceklerini araştırıyor. Öyleyse, konuya girelim ve HTML küçültücülerin web siteleri oluşturma ve sürdürmede nasıl devrim yaratabileceğini keşfedelim.
PermalinkVerimli kodlama nedir?
Verimli kodlama, web sitelerinin hızlı bir şekilde yüklenmesini ve sorunsuz çalışmasını sağlayan temiz, özlü ve optimize edilmiş kod yazmayı ifade eder. Verimli kodlama, her kod satırının bir amaca hizmet etmesini ve web sitesi performansına katkıda bulunmasını sağlar. Programlama tekniklerini kullanmayı, kodlama standartlarına bağlı kalmayı ve geliştirmeyi kolaylaştıran araçlardan yararlanmayı içerir.
PermalinkWeb Sitesi Performansının Önemi
Web sitesi performansı, kullanıcı deneyiminde ve iş başarısında çok önemli bir rol oynar. Araştırmalar, yüklenmesi daha az zaman alırsa kullanıcıların bir web sitesini terk etme olasılığının daha yüksek olduğunu keşfetti. Yavaş yüklenen web siteleri kullanıcıları hayal kırıklığına uğratır ve arama motoru sıralamalarına zarar verir. Bu nedenle, sorunsuz bir kullanıcı deneyimi sunmak ve organik trafik çekmek için web sitesi performansını optimize etmek çok önemlidir.
PermalinkHTML küçültücülerini anlama
HTML küçültücüler, işlevselliği değiştirmeden gereksiz karakterleri, beyaz boşlukları ve yorumları kaldırarak HTML kodunu optimize eder. HTML dosyalarını derleyerek daha küçük dosya boyutları ve gelişmiş yükleme hızları sağlarlar.
• HTML Minifikerlerinin Tanımı: HTML küçültücüler, HTML kodundan gereksiz karakterleri, beyaz boşlukları ve yorumları otomatik olarak kaldırarak kompakt ve optimize edilmiş dosyalar sağlar.
• HTML Minifiers Nasıl Çalışır: HTML minifikatörleri, HTML kodunu ayrıştırmak ve beyaz boşluklar, satır sonları ve yorumlar gibi gereksiz öğeleri ortadan kaldırmak için algoritmalar kullanır. Bu işlem, dosya boyutunu küçülterek daha hızlı indirmeler ve web tarayıcıları tarafından daha iyi işleme sağlar.
• HTML Minifier'ların Faydaları: HTML küçültücüler, azaltılmış dosya boyutu, daha hızlı sayfa yükleme süreleri, azaltılmış bant genişliği kullanımı ve gelişmiş bir kullanıcı deneyimi dahil olmak üzere çeşitli avantajlar sunar. Küçültülmüş HTML dosyalarının bakımı ve aktarılması da daha kolaydır.
PermalinkHTML Minifiers ile Web Sitesi Performansını İyileştirin
HTML küçültücüler web sitesi performansını artırır. Bunu başarmanın bazı yollarını keşfedelim.
• Daha Hızlı Sayfa Yükleme Süreleri: Küçültülmüş HTML dosyaları daha küçük dosya boyutlarına sahiptir, bu da web tarayıcıları tarafından daha hızlı indirilip oluşturulabilecekleri anlamına gelir. Daha hızlı sayfa yükleme süresi, sayfa yükleme sürelerinin azalmasına ve daha iyi bir kullanıcı deneyimine yol açar.
• Azaltılmış Bant Genişliği Kullanımı: HTML küçültücüler, gereksiz karakterleri ve boşlukları kaldırarak sunucudan kullanıcının cihazına aktarılan verileri azaltır. Azaltılmış bant genişliği kullanımı, bant genişliği kullanımını azaltır ve masaüstü ve mobil cihazlarda web sitesinin yüklenmesini hızlandırır.
• Gelişmiş Kullanıcı Deneyimi: Hızlı yüklenen web siteleri, sorunsuz tarama deneyimleri sağlar. Kodu optimize eden HTML küçültücülerle, web siteleri daha duyarlı ve verimli hale gelir, kullanıcı katılımını artırır ve hemen çıkma oranlarını azaltır.
PermalinkPiyasadaki Yaygın HTML Minifierleri
Tüm özelliklere ve işlevlere sahip HTML küçültücüler piyasada mevcuttur. Birkaç popüler olanı keşfedelim.
• Küçült: Küçült, HTML, CSS ve JavaScript dosyalarını sıkıştıran, yaygın olarak kullanılan bir HTML küçültücüdür. Küçültme seviyelerini kontrol etmek ve mevcut geliştirme iş akışlarına entegre etmek için özelleştirilebilir ayarlar sağlar.
• HTMLMinifier: HTMLMinifier, HTML kodunu küçültmek için güçlü bir araçtır. İsteğe bağlı etiketlerin kaldırılması, beyaz boşlukların daraltılması ve öznitelik değerlerinin kısaltılması gibi küçültme işleminde ince ayar yapmak için gelişmiş seçenekler sunar.
• UglifyHTML: UglifyHTML, sadeliği ve etkinliği ile bilinen bir başka popüler HTML küçültücüdür. İşaretleme işlevselliğini ve yapısını korurken HTML kod boyutunu en aza indirmeye odaklanır.
PermalinkHTML Minifier'ları için En İyi Uygulamalar
HTML küçültücülerden en iyi şekilde yararlanmak için bazı en iyi uygulamaları takip etmek çok önemlidir. Aşağıdaki ipuçlarını göz önünde bulundurun:
• Küçültme Seçenekleri: Seçtiğiniz HTML küçültücüdeki mevcut seçenekleri keşfedin ve dosya boyutunu küçültme ile kod okunabilirliği arasındaki en uygun dengeyi keşfetmek için çeşitli ayarlarla denemeler yapın.
• Potansiyel Sorunları Ele Alma: HTML küçültücüler genellikle doğru sonuçlar verirken, küçültülmüş kodu kapsamlı bir şekilde test etmek ve bozuk bağlantılar veya eksik işlevsellik gibi ortaya çıkabilecek olası sorunları ele almak çok önemlidir.
PermalinkHTML Minifier'ları Geliştirme Sürecine Entegre Etme
HTML küçültücülerini geliştirme iş akışına entegre etmek, küçültmeyi kolaylaştırmak için çok önemlidir. İşte bunu yapmanın bazı yolları:
• Derleme Araçları ve Görev Çalıştırıcıları: HTML küçültücüleri derleme araçlarına ve Gulp veya Grunt gibi görev çalıştırıcılarına dahil edin. Küçültme sürecini otomatikleştirerek, araçlar optimizasyonu gerçekleştirirken geliştiricilerin temiz kod yazmaya odaklanmasına olanak tanır.
• Otomasyon ve Sürekli Entegrasyon: HTML küçültmenin geliştirme ve dağıtım sırasında sorunsuz bir şekilde gerçekleşmesini sağlamak için Git kancaları veya CI/CD ardışık düzenleri gibi araçları kullanarak otomatik süreçler ayarlayın.
PermalinkHTML Minifiers ile SEO Hususları
HTML küçültücüler çok sayıda avantaj sunarken, arama motoru optimizasyonu üzerindeki etkilerini göz önünde bulundurmak çok önemlidir. Dikkat edilmesi gereken bazı noktalar aşağıda verilmiştir.
• Arama Motoru Sıralamaları Üzerindeki Etkisi: HTML küçültme, sıralamaları doğrudan etkilemez. Bununla birlikte, küçültülmüş HTML'den kaynaklanan gelişmiş web sitesi performansı, sayfa yükleme hızı bir sıralama faktörü olduğundan, sıralamaları dolaylı olarak etkileyebilir.
• Meta Veri Koruma: Başlık etiketleri, meta açıklamalar ve yapılandırılmış veriler gibi kritik meta verilerin küçültme sırasında korunduğundan emin olun. Meta veri koruması, arama motorlarının içeriği hala anlayabilmesini ve dizine ekleyebilmesini sağlar.
PermalinkKüçültme ve okunabilirliği dengeleme
HTML küçültücüler dosya boyutlarını küçültür; Geliştiricilerin okunabilir koda ihtiyacı vardır. Dengeleme küçültme ve okunabilirlik şunları içerir:
• Kodun okunabilirliğini artırmak için uygun girinti ve satır sonları kullanma.
• Kodun amacını ve işlevselliğini belgeleyen anlamlı yorumları korumak.
• Küçültülmüş kodun optimizasyondan sonra bile yönetilebilir ve anlaşılır kalmasını sağlamak.
PermalinkHTML Kodunu Küçültme: Adım Adım Kılavuz
HTML küçültmeye başlamanıza yardımcı olmak için işte adım adım bir kılavuz:
1. Doğru HTML Minifier'ı Seçme: Proje gereksinimlerinize uygun bir HTML küçültücüyü araştırın ve seçin. Kullanım kolaylığı, özelleştirme seçenekleri ve topluluk desteği gibi faktörleri göz önünde bulundurun.
2. Yapılandırma ve Kurulum: HTML küçültücüyü projenizin ihtiyaçlarına göre kurun ve yapılandırın. Beyaz boşlukları kaldırma, öznitelikleri daraltma veya yorumları kaldırma gibi istenen küçültme seçeneklerini ayarlayın.
3. HTML Dosyalarını Küçültme: HTML dosyalarınızı işlemek için bir HTML küçültücü kullanın. Seçtiğiniz araca bağlı olarak tek tek dosyaları veya tüm dizinleri küçültebilirsiniz. Küçültme işlemine başlamadan önce orijinal dosyalarınızın yedeklerini oluşturduğunuzdan emin olun.
PermalinkKüçültülmüş HTML'yi Test Etme ve Optimize Etme
HTML kodunu küçülttükten sonra, küçültülmüş dosyaları test etmek ve optimize etmek çok önemlidir. Aşağıdaki adımları göz önünde bulundurun:
• Kalite Güvencesi: Tüm işlevlerin ve görsel öğelerin amaçlandığı gibi çalıştığından emin olmak için küçültmeden sonra web sitesini kapsamlı bir şekilde test edin. Etkileşimli özelliklere, formlara ve dinamik olarak oluşturulan içeriğe çok dikkat edin.
• Performans Testi: Web sitesi performansını ölçmek için Google PageSpeed Insights veya GTmetrix gibi araçları kullanın. Sonuçları analiz edin ve web sitesi hızını ve kullanıcı deneyimini geliştirmek için gerekli optimizasyonları yapın.
PermalinkVaka Çalışmaları: HTML Minifiers ile Başarı Hikayeleri
Birkaç web sitesi, HTML küçültücüleri uygulayarak önemli performans iyileştirmeleri elde etti. İlham almak ve gerçek dünyadan örneklerden öğrenmek için vaka çalışmalarını ve başarı hikayelerini keşfedin.
PermalinkHTML Minification'da Gelecek Trendler
HTML küçültme alanı, devam eden araştırma ve geliştirme ile gelişmeye devam ediyor. HTML küçültmede gelecekteki bazı potansiyel eğilimler şunları içerir:
• Akıllı Küçültme Algoritmaları: HTML kodundaki belirli kalıpları otomatik olarak algılayan ve optimize eden gelişmiş algoritmalar, daha da verimli küçültme sağlar.
• İçerik Dağıtım Ağları (CDN'ler) ile Entegrasyon: Optimize edilmiş içerik teslimi ve önbelleğe alma yetenekleri sağlamak için HTML küçültücülerin CDN'lerle sorunsuz entegrasyonu, web sitesi performansını daha da artırır.
PermalinkSon
Verimli kodlama uygulamaları, günümüzün dijital ortamında çok önemlidir. HTML küçültücüler, dosya boyutlarını azaltarak ve yükleme sürelerini iyileştirerek web sitesi performansını optimize etmek için değerli bir çözüm sunar. HTML küçültücüleri geliştirme sürecinize dahil ederek, en iyi uygulamalara bağlı kalırken hızlı ve sorunsuz bir kullanıcı deneyimi sağlayabilirsiniz. HTML küçültücülerin gücünü benimseyin ve hedef kitlenizi yakalayan yüksek performanslı web siteleri oluşturma potansiyelini ortaya çıkarın.
PermalinkSıkça Sorulan Sorular
Permalink1. HTML küçültme nedir?
HTML küçültme, dosya boyutlarını küçültmek ve web sitesi performansını artırmak için HTML kodundan gereksiz karakterleri, boşlukları ve yorumları kaldırır.
Permalink2. HTML küçültme web sitemin işlevselliğini etkiler mi?
Düzgün bir şekilde uygulanan HTML küçültme, web sitenizin işlevselliğini korumalıdır. Ancak, her şeyin amaçlandığı gibi çalıştığından emin olmak için küçültülmüş kodu kapsamlı bir şekilde test etmek çok önemlidir.
Permalink3. HTML kodu herhangi bir araç kullanmadan manuel olarak küçültülebilir mi?
HTML kodunu manuel olarak küçültmek mümkün olsa da, zaman alıcı ve hataya açık olabilir. Verimli ve doğru sonuçlar için HTML küçültücü araçlar önerilir.
Permalink4. HTML küçültücüler CSS ve JavaScript küçültmeyi de destekliyor mu?
HTML küçültücüler ayrıca CSS ve JavaScript dosyalarını da sıkıştırır. Ancak, daha kesin optimizasyonlar için CSS ve JavaScript'i küçültmek için özel araçlar kullanmanız önerilir.
Permalink5. HTML kodumu ne sıklıkla küçültmeliyim?
HTML kodu, kod tabanında her değişiklik yapıldığında geliştirme sırasında küçültülmelidir. Ek olarak, tutarlı bir iyileştirme sağlamak için dağıtım işlem hattınıza HTML küçültme eklemeniz önerilir.